Naman Dhir is an Indian cricketer who comes from Ambala. He was born on December 31st, 1999, in Ambala. Naman is a right-handed batting all-rounder who also bowls right-arm off-break. In the Indian Premier League, he plays cricket for the Mumbai Indians and for the Punjab State team in domestic cricket.

Naman Dhir Education
His early education was marked by his passion for cricket, which he pursued despite various challenges. Naman received schooling from Kendriya Vidyalaya Faridkot and earned a bachelor’s degree in Arts. He completed this degree at Baba Farid College, situated in Bathinda.
Early Life And Cricket Aspiration
From a very young age, he was interested in cricket as a sport, and his passion for it was also supported by his close family. He honed his cricket-playing skills through local coaching and participation in age-group tournaments. However, his journey into cricket was not very smooth as he faced setbacks in his career in 2022.
At that moment, his career was not going great, so he decided to quit cricket and moved to Canada, where his sister lives. But his family’s support helps him to persevere for one more year, which also becomes a turning point in his life.
Naman Dhir Family Details
He comes from a middle-class family in Ambala, Haryana, and they played an important role in his entire cricket journey. His father, Naresh Dhir, works at a chemist’s shop. On the other hand, his mother, Nirupama Dhir, is a teacher.
In his family, he also had two older sisters, Manila Naresh and Sheenam Ralhan, one of whom lives in Canada. When he faced a setback in his cricket career, his father was the one who supported and convinced him to give his cricket career another shot. His father’s motivation led to his selection by the Mumbai Indians.
Additionally, in one of his interviews, Naman mentioned that the role of his maternal grandfather and his childhood coach played a significant role in his early cricket career. However, both of them have now passed away.
Naman Dhir Cricket Journey
Given below are the aspects of Naman Dhir’s Cricket Journey from the beginning:
Domestic Journey
Early Domestic Career: His professional journey began when he was selected to play for the Haryana Under-19 team. Later, he made his List A debut for his home ground, Haryana, back in 2017-18 for the Vijay Hazare Trophy. Then made First-Class Debut in the year 2018-19 for the Ranji Trophy.
Breakthrough Season: In the years 2022-23, he has pulled up impressive performances by scoring two centuries in the Ranji Trophy, including a notable 134 runs against Saurashtra.
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y: In the 2023-2024 season, he was a member of the Punjab team that won the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y. In the series, he was contributing with both bat and ball.
IPL Journey
IPL Debut: Following his domestic performance, Namand Dhir was also picked for the 2024 IPL Season. The team that selected him to play in the franchise was the Mumbai Indians, who were led by Hardik Pandya back in 2024. His first match of the season was on March 24th, 2025, against the Gujarat Titans, which was led by Shubhman Gill.
IPL Success and Re-Acquisition: In the 2024 IPL season, he accumulated 140 runs at a strike rate of 177.21. Naman’s impressive performance in 2024 sparked a bidding war in the 2025 IPL auction. Here, the Mumbai Indians re-acquired him for the price money of 5.25 crore using their right to match (RTM) card.
